Off-contract Sutherland Shire footballers Jacob Tratt and Cameron Devlin are in discussions with Sydney FC over their futures.
Both could stay with the A-League champions despite not being on the club's list of retained players.
Sydney FC midfielder Josh Brillante is also among the the 12 players not on Sydney's retained list announced on Monday, but the Socceroo is also in talks about signing a new deal with the club.
The 26-year-old nearly signed for South Korean club Pohang Steelers earlier this year, but the deal fell through and he ended up playing in Sydney's grand final win over Perth earlier this month.
As expected, the Sky Blues have cut ties with foreigners Siem de Jong, Reza Ghoochannejhad and Jop van der Linden.
De Jong and 'Gucci' have returned to their parent clubs Ajax and APOEL after mixed success from their loan stints in Sydney, while van der Linden will be remembered as a poor recruitment choice after notching just nine A-League appearances and having been frozen out of the first-team picture for the second half of the season.
The trio join retired captain Alex Brosque and Helensburgh junior Aaron Calver, who is off to new A-League club Western United, in the exit lane for Sydney.
Alex Cisak and Mitch Austin will also not return next season.
Young striker Chris Zuvela is out of contract but will remain at the club to continue his recovery from a knee injury before his future is determined.
Loanees Anthony Caceres and Danny De Silva have all returned to their parent clubs, but Sydney are in negotiations with Manchester City and Central Coast about Caceres and De Silva returning next season.
"You have been so good to me and my family, we'll never forget it," Ghoochannejhad said via Twitter.
The Iranian striker's departure, as well as those of Dutch duo de Jong and van der Linden, means Sydney will have three vacant visa spots for their 2019-20 campaign.
"We have retained a large proportion of our championship winning team and I expect to recruit a number of exciting new players to add to that core," coach Steve Corica said.
SYDNEY FC CONTRACTED PLAYERS FOR 2019-20: Andrew Redmayne, Benjamin Warland, Alex Wilkinson, Michael Zullo, Paulo Retre, Adam Le Fondre, Milos Ninkovic, Trent Buhagiar, Brandon O'Neill, Rhyan Grant, Joel King, Tom Heward-Belle, Luke Ivanovic.
